N-iX vs Innowise: overview
N-iX
N-iX is an engineering and technology consulting company founded in 2002 in Lviv, Ukraine, with offices in Stockholm, Sweden and the United States, employing 2,000+ engineers. The firm's AI and ML practice is built on top of strong data engineering capabilities, with a dedicated MLOps practice that has documented production deployments at named clients including Bosch, Gogo, Dematic, Lebara, AVL, and Fluke. N-iX excels where AI depends on solid data infrastructure, offering full-stack ML delivery from data pipeline engineering through model deployment and monitoring. The company serves Fortune 500 enterprises as a recognised engineering partner.
Innowise
Innowise is a software development company headquartered in Warsaw, Poland with offices in Dubai, UAE, serving clients across banking, healthcare, agriculture, and other industries. The firm employs 1,200+ engineers and delivers machine learning solutions for automating routine tasks, implementing forecasting systems, and improving customer experiences. Innowise's ML practice covers data preparation, model development, and post-deployment monitoring, integrated within broader software product delivery. The company operates across multiple geographies, with delivery teams primarily in Eastern Europe.
